Augusta Mall trespasser assaults deputy, faces charges

AUGUSTA, Ga ()- A woman is in jail tonight after the Richmond County Sheriff’s Office says she hit a deputy with a car.

The RCSO was called to the Augusta Mall just before 3:30 Saturday afternoon to respond to a trespasser on the property.

Toni Wallace was banned from the mall on June 19, and told she wasn’t allowed to come back. The mall security officer who banned her saw her on the property and called RCSO. Wallace’s criminal history shows 5 previous shoplifting arrests along with other charges.

After watching security camera video, Wallace was positively identified, and Deputy Jeff Adams searched for her.

He found her in the parking lot in a white 2020 Nissan Altima. Deputy Adams approached the car waving his hands and instructing her to stop.

Wallace ignored the commands and accelerated the car, hitting the deputy, causing injury to his hand and knee. He was taken to Piedmont Hospital where he was treated and expected to make a full recovery.

Investigators contacted the owner of the car who confirmed that Wallace had been using it all day Saturday.

Investigators and road patrol deputies then made contact with Wallace who was placed into custody without incident.

Following an interview with investigators, Wallace confessed to both trespassing at the Augusta Mall and driving the vehicle that hit Deputy Adams.

Wallace was arrested and charged with Aggravated Assault upon a Police Officer, Criminal Trespass, and a shoplifting charge is pending.

The incident is still under investigation.
